3.

一个凸 1818 边形的各角度数组成一个递增的等差数列,并且每个角度都是整数。求最小角的度数。

The degree measures of the angles of a convex 1818-sided polygon form an increasing arithmetic sequence with integer values. Find the degree measure of the smallest angle.

答案:143
知识点:角度和等差数列奇偶性
难度评级:1920
解答:

一个 1818 边形的内角和为 18016=2880180 \cdot 16 = 2880 度。若最小角为 aa,公差为 dd,则 18a+153d=288018a + 153d = 2880,即 2a+17d=3202a + 17d = 320。因为 aadd 都是整数,17d17d 必须为偶数,所以 dd 是偶数;又因为数列递增,d2d \ge 2

凸性要求最大角 a+17d=320+17d2a + 17d = \frac{320 + 17d}{2} 小于 180180,所以 17d<4017d \lt 40,从而 d2d \le 2。因此 d=2d = 2,且 a=320342=143a = \frac{320 - 34}{2} = 143

The interior angles of an 1818-gon sum to 18016=2880180 \cdot 16 = 2880 degrees. If the smallest angle is aa and the common difference is d,d, then 18a+153d=2880,18a + 153d = 2880, i.e. 2a+17d=320.2a + 17d = 320. Since aa and dd are integers, 17d17d must be even, so dd is even, and d2d \ge 2 because the sequence is increasing.

Convexity requires the largest angle a+17d=320+17d2a + 17d = \frac{320 + 17d}{2} to be less than 180,180, so 17d<4017d \lt 40 and d2.d \le 2. Thus d=2d = 2 and a=320342=143.a = \frac{320 - 34}{2} = 143.
